Download The Latest Ruby Book with Source Codes Here…

July 7, 2008

The Book Of Ruby…

The Book Of Ruby is a comprehensive free tutorial to the Ruby language. Eventually it will form a book of more than 400 pages in 20 chapters.

It is being provided in the form of a PDF document in which each chapter is accompanied by ready-to-run source code for all the examples. The Introduction explains how to use this source code in Ruby In Steel or any other editor/IDE of your choice.

The Book Of Ruby is written by Huw Collingbourne - one of the developers of the Ruby In Steel IDE.

It is being provided here on the Sapphire Steel Software site as a PDF book which will grow as chapters are added.

Currently 3 chapters are available with source codes.

INTRODUCTION
- GETTING STARTED WITH RUBY

* How To Read This Book
* Digging Deeper
* Making Sense Of The Text

- RUBY AND RAILS

* What Is Ruby?
* What Is Rails?
* Download Ruby
* Get The Source Code Of The Sample Programs
* Running Ruby Programs
* The Ruby Library Documentation

Chapter One
- STRINGS, NUMBERS, CLASSES AND OBJECTS

* Getting and Putting Input
* Strings and Embedded Evaluation
* Numbers
* Testing a Condition: if … then
* Local and Global Variables
* Classes and Objects
* Instance Variables
* Messages, Methods and Polymorphism
* Constructors – new and initialize
* Inspecting Objects

Chapter Two
- CLASS HIERARCHIES, ATTRIBUTES AND CLASS VARIABLES

* Superclasses and Subclasses
* Passing Arguments To The Superclass
* Accessor Methods
* ‘Set’ Accessors
* Attribute Readers and Writers
* Calling Methods of a Superclass
* Class Variables
- DIGGING DEEPER
* Superclasses
* Constants Inside Classes
* Partial Classes

Chapter Three
- STRINGS AND RANGES

* User-Defined String Delimiters
* Backquotes
* String Handling
- DIGGING DEEPER
* Ranges
* Iterating With A Range
* Heredocs
* String Literals

Download Like is here.
http://www.sapphiresteel.com/IMG/zip/book-of-ruby.zip

Namaste

Entry Filed under: Books. Tags: .

5 Comments Add your own

Leave a Comment

Required

Required, hidden

Some HTML allowed:
<a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<pre>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>

Trackback this post  |  Subscribe to the comments via RSS Feed


Follow me on Twitter